3-Day Itinerary for Chikamangalore

  1. Day 1: Mullayanagiri Peak
    25 minutes (8.9 km) from Chikmagalur

    In the morning, head to Mullayanagiri Peak, the highest peak in Karnataka. It offers breathtaking views of the surrounding hills and is a perfect spot for nature enthusiasts and adventure seekers. For lunch, try a local restaurant and savour the traditional cuisine of the region. In the afternoon, visit the Bhadra Wildlife Sanctuary, a popular destination for wildlife lovers. It is home to many species of animals and birds, including tigers, leopards and elephants. In the evening, head to the Baba Budangiri Hills, a scenic spot known for its beautiful sunset views.

  2. Day 2: Kudremukh National Park
    1 hour 30 minutes (60 km) from Chikmagalur

    Start the day early and take a drive to the Kudremukh National Park, one of the most picturesque destinations in the region. The park is known for its stunning scenery, waterfalls and dense forests, and is home to many species of animals, birds and plants. Take a guided trek through the park to explore its beauty and diversity. For lunch, head to a local restaurant and try some of the delicious local delicacies. In the afternoon, visit the Sringeri Sharada Peetham, a historic temple known for its intricate architecture and religious significance. In the evening, relax at the nearby Agumbe Rainforest, known for its stunning sunset views.

  3. Day 3: Coffee Museum and Hebbe Falls
    1 hour 10 minutes (37 km) from Chikmagalur

    Start the day with a visit to the Coffee Museum, which showcases the history of coffee production in the region. Learn about the cultivation, processing and roasting of coffee beans and enjoy a freshly brewed cup of coffee. In the afternoon, head to Hebbe Falls, a beautiful waterfall surrounded by lush greenery. Take a dip in the cool waters of the falls and relax in the serene surroundings. For dinner, try a local restaurant and indulge in the delicious cuisine of the region. In the evening, head back to Chikmagalur and explore the local markets and shops.

Recommendations

If you have more time, consider visiting the Belur and Halebidu temples, which are known for their exquisite architecture and rich cultural heritage. You could also take a side trip to the nearby hill stations of Coorg and Wayanad. To maximize your fun, try some of the adventure activities such as trekking, rock climbing and camping, which are available in the region. Don't forget to bring comfortable clothing, sunscreen and insect repellent, as well as a camera to capture the stunning scenery.
